你查询的IP:[119.128.113.95]  地理位置:中国–广东–东莞

最新查询222.64.231.168 117.112.216.34 123.8.10.127 166.111.104.91 123.196.143.129 222.176.74.111 123.249.1.171 114.60.7.1 116.69.196.186 119.128.113.95 210.25.16.85 125.213.240.47 222.168.118.64 202.38.146.89 122.64.91.248 202.38.160.90 221.13.31.106 121.52.208.34 122.22.64.214 125.210.37.254 202.131.16.54 218.55.41.94 60.208.12.53 202.90.224.35 116.214.32.13 116.198.67.244 125.169.51.0 121.201.51.114 114.68.46.58 125.216.234.174 220.234.75.108